**First-day checklist item 7: Bike cage and parking gates (Facilities desk)**

Before the new starter arrives, confirm their name appears on the Orvell Park vehicle register and that their bike-cage request, if any, was approved by the Grounds team. Walk them to the south parking gates, demonstrate the intercom fallback in case the reader fails, and show the cage's inner latch, which must be re-secured after every entry. Remind them the gates lock automatically at 19:30. Until their badge is programmed, they should use the gate code below.

door code, yagap-bahof: bdg-O-05

// Retention sweeper client setup — Vaultmow service
//
// This client connects to the Shelfrun retention API and deletes
// blobs older than the policy window defined in sweep_policy.toml.
// Do not widen the scope: the sweeper is intentionally blind to
// legal-hold buckets, which Shelfrun filters server-side.
// Batch size is capped at 500 to avoid starving the Nightloom
// indexer. If you change the endpoint, update the smoke test in
// sweeper_check.go as well. The client authenticates with the
// internal key that follows.

service key, fawip-bajef: kto11_Qt5wZK9vdNC

## Formula sandbox tuning

User-supplied formulas in Gridmoor execute inside a restricted interpreter with hard ceilings on time, memory, and call depth. Reviewers should confirm any change to these ceilings is justified in the PR description, since raising them widens the abuse surface. Defaults were chosen from production traces. The current limits are as follows.

limits module of tafog-fawip:
WEIGHTS = {
    "julix": 57,
    "lamys": 992,
    "kasvan": 209,
    "quenok": 750,
    "alddor": 259,
    "oliath": 1009,
    "wenix": 815,
}

Welcome to the Ledgerglass team. The audit-log viewer renders only signed log segments; anything unsigned is flagged and quarantined for review. As a security reviewer, you'll need to verify segment signatures locally before approving access-pattern reports. Verification requires the current segment-signing key, which is rotated monthly and announced in the review channel. For your initial setup, the current key appears below.

release key, fahaf-bajof: bky3_Xam